Cooking Frozen Mozzarella Sticks
Frozen mozzarella sticks are the most convenient option. Here’s how to prepare them:
1. Arrange on a Plate: Place the sticks in a single layer on a microwave-safe plate, leaving some space between them.
2. Cover with a Paper Towel: Drape a damp paper towel over the sticks. This helps keep moisture in, further preventing sogginess.
3. Microwave in Intervals: Set the microwave to medium power and cook for 30 seconds. Afterward, check for melty consistency and adjust in 15-second intervals until they reach your desired level of meltiness.
Keep an eye on the cheese as it can start to ooze out if left too long. Aim for a soft but not overly runny texture.
Cooking Homemade Mozzarella Sticks
If you’re crafting mozzarella sticks from scratch, follow these steps:
1. Bread the Sticks: Start by cutting mozzarella into sticks and breading them thoroughly with eggs and seasoned breadcrumbs.
2. Chill Before Microwaving: Once breaded, chill them in the fridge for about 30 minutes. This helps the coating set, resulting in a firmer texture when cooked.
3. Microwave Cooking: Place the sticks on a microwave-safe plate and cover with a damp paper towel as mentioned earlier. Cook in 30-second intervals, checking after each round.
You’ll want to achieve that signature melt without compromising the breading’s integrity.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Even with the best intentions, things can go awry. Here are common mistakes to avoid when microwaving mozzarella sticks:
Skipping Thawing
Microwaving frozen sticks without thawing leads to uneven cooking. Always thaw for the best results.
Overcooking
It’s easy to lose track of time. Overcooked mozzarella sticks become rubbery, so intermittent checking is vital.
Using Non-Microwave Safe Containers
Be sure to only use containers labeled microwave-safe. Unsafe containers can warp or even release harmful chemicals.
